  4. #4

    Re: Spec for Patch 3.0 or w/e comes out tmrw

    The obvious downside to your second spec is that you have to sacrifice Meditation and Inner Focus, 2 talents that have been staples in every major priest healing spec pre-3.0.

    There are a few deep holy talents based on mana regen / conservation, but I doubt the developers designed them to take the place of Meditation.

    Guardian Spirit seems like a cool skill, definitely worth playing around with, but whether it will make your second spec "better" will probably depend on whether you can still heal without going OOM in the long fights.
